Tsurugashima is located in Saitama Prefecture, Japan, with GPS coordinates of 35.95996, 139.40283. It is situated in the Kanto region, approximately 40 kilometers northwest of central Tokyo. The city operates within the Asia/Tokyo timezone, which is UTC+9.

Timezone in Tsurugashima
Tsurugashima is located in the Asia/Tokyo timezone, which has a UTC offset of +9 hours. Japan does not observe daylight saving time, so this offset remains constant throughout the year. This means that the time in Tsurugashima will not change, unlike in many parts of the United States, where daylight saving time can shift the clock by one hour, typically moving forward in March and back in November.

Attractions and Activities in Tsurugashima
Tsurugashima is a city located in Saitama Prefecture, Japan, known for its residential character and proximity to larger urban centers like Tokyo. It features a blend of suburban life with access to natural landscapes, including parks and rivers that provide recreational opportunities. The city is part of the Kanto region, which is recognized for its historical significance and agricultural activities.
While Tsurugashima may not have the extensive tourist attractions of larger cities, it is characterized by its community-driven events and local festivals, which often highlight traditional Japanese culture. The city is also known for its cherry blossoms in spring, drawing visitors who appreciate the seasonal beauty of Japan. The surrounding area is rich in rice paddies and offers a glimpse into the agricultural lifestyle of the region, contributing to the cultural fabric of Saitama Prefecture.
